    Any RPG system is atleast somewhat based on luck. 30 dodge means roughly 30% chance they will dodge, 95% hit means there is a 5% chance you will miss. Damage range, non-maxed crit all play a factor. Certainly luck isnt the only deciding factor in a match, but sometimes you will fight someone and regardless of how well you play, you may lose. The idea is that the more you play, the more your luck will average out and you can see how skilled you are compared to others.
